The table below provides summary statistics and salary benchmarking for jobs advertised in England requiring MongoDB skills. It covers permanent job vacancies from the 6 months leading up to 12 August 2026, with comparisons to the same periods in the previous two years.

6 months to
12 Aug 2026
Same period 2025 Same period 2024
Rank 248 330 253
Rank change year-on-year +82 -77 +30
Permanent jobs citing MongoDB 733 378 805
As % of all permanent jobs in England 0.78% 0.87% 1.11%
As % of the Database & Business Intelligence category 9.03% 5.57% 7.14%
Number of salaries quoted 616 278 409
10th Percentile £42,500 £46,600 £42,500
25th Percentile £47,500 £55,000 £46,250
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£57,500 £67,500 £65,000
Median % change year-on-year -14.81% +3.85% -3.70%
75th Percentile £74,987 £86,250 £80,000
90th Percentile £88,148 £107,500 £99,000
UK median annual salary £57,500 £67,500 £62,500
% change year-on-year -14.81% +8.00% -7.41%
